SITE RELIABILITY ENGINEER | €50,000 - €68,000 | RELOCATE TO NETHERLANDS WITH WORK VISA SPONSORSHIP

Being a Site Reliability Engineer, you'll play a key role within our infrastructure team. Within this team you will be responsible for building secure, scalable, reusable infrastructure architecture. You will work on creating effective high-quality cloud based secure solutions to prevent our systems from failing and you will set up clear monitoring mechanisms for the times it does. To do so you’ll be working with Docker, Amazon Web Services, Kubernetes, Terraform and Python. Throughout your work you’ll remain self-critical, use a sound rationale and follow our existing procedures. On occasion some creativity may be needed too though. On a day-to-day basis you will spend a lot of time coding and building infrastructure process automations. You’re constantly on the lookout to find solutions to further improve our infrastructure and prevent future outages. Throughout your day you will work very closely with the team of Site Reliability Engineers and effectively communicate with them when needed. Requirements

As a Site Reliability Engineer you’re able to bring:
 

  • A self-starter mentality, being able to take the lead on new infrastructure projects and proactively detect and resolve existing infrastructural issues.

  • A desire to automate as much of your work as possible.

  • An analytical mindset with an intrinsic sense of curiosity; being able to see the bigger picture and wanting to understand how things are working at all levels of the system.

  • A high sense of responsibility for our infrastructure and the ability to be a reliable force within the team.

  • Good communication skills; high proficiency in English and the ability to clearly and concretely express yourself.

  • Your honesty opinion and an ability to provide constructive feedback to others.

  • Positivity attitude; always looking for ways to create a welcoming environment for colleagues and never shy to take action where needed.

  • A critical view; always looking for ways to further improve your own and our teams efforts.

  • A desire to share knowledge and the ability to act as a mentor to others.


 

 
In addition, you’re able to bring the following technical expertise:
 

  • 3-5 years of experience in setting up infrastructure projects using tools such as Docker, Amazon Web Services, Kubernetes, Terraform and Python.

  • Extensive knowledge of cloud security and best practices in the industry (e.g. knowledge of the principle of least privilege, Kubernetes cluster security and web application firewalls).

  • Very good understanding of REST API principles and internal structure.

  • Hands-on experience with Git, CI/CD systems.

  • Strong coding skills, preferably Python or Go.

  • Efficient working in a Scrum team and collaboration with the other teams across Payconiq.

  • Experience in the financial/payments domain (considered as an advantage).

  • Knowledge of security certifications (considered as an advantage).

Not sold just yet? Have a peek at some of our perks
 

  • Salary of EUR 50.000 – 68.000 gross per year including 8% vacation allowance.

  • 25 vacation days per year with the possibility to purchase up to 10 extra days.

  • Pension plan (pension contribution fully paid for by us, no personal contribution necessary).

  • Training Budget: 5% of annual gross salary (in addition to your base salary).

  • Structural WFH Policy: hybrid model with a WFH allowance as well as home office supplies.

  • Commuting allowance.

  • Hardware: a MacBook (Pro or Air) and a mobile phone policy.

  • Relocation package: Visa sponsorship and a relocation stipe in to be received together with your first paycheck (if you are from outside The Netherlands).
